High-Rise Window Repair
Regularly, high-rise building windows need to be repaired. These windows are usually too high for the average person to reach, and only professionals equipped with the right tools and experience can access them. Repairs often required in high-rise buildings include sealing and replacing or repairing window sills. Other repairs include fixing leaks, water damage, and replacing damaged glass. These tasks can be complicated dependent on the type and extent of damage. Only professionals should be able to handle them.
Replacing a window's pane can cost between $300 to $880, based on the size of the pane as well as the extent of damage. Broken windows can be the result of wear and tear or an accident. It is also possible they are reaching the end of their life expectancy and will require to be replaced entirely.
The cost of repairing a window frame ranges between 250 and 600 dollars. The repairman will typically remove the parts that are rotten from the frame, then replace them with new wood or fill in the holes with resin. This repair is essential to ensure the structural integrity of the structure, as rotting wood can compromise the structure.
A damaged window lock can cost between $100 and $200 to repair. window repair near me locks guard the contents of a room from thieves and intruders. If yours is broken it's important to fix it as soon as you can.
It can be costly to remove scratches from glass, but it's vital to maintain the quality of windows. Professionals employ scratch removal kits or tools that can remove scratches and remove them without causing further damage to the window's surface or coatings.
The cost of a window repair at a high rise is contingent on the amount of the work that needs to be completed. Before beginning repairs, a professional will usually conduct a thorough assessment of the damage. They will then give an exact estimate of the cost. You will be able to budget more effectively when you know the costs involved. The window replacement company you choose should be insured and licensed for your protection.

Residential Window Repair
Windows are essential because they let light into your home and provide a beautiful view. They also help to shield your home from the elements. If your windows are damaged or not functioning properly, it can impact the efficiency of your home's energy use and curb appeal. A window doctor near me can assist with any problems you may have regarding your windows for residential use.
Residential window repair services are available for glass replacement frames, window frame repair and sash double glazing repairs near me. Cracked or broken windows can be fixed with an epoxy system that allows you to fill in the cracks and restore the window's aesthetic. The contractor can also replace the latches if the sash won't remain closed.
Look for a company that offers insurance and a guarantee on their services when choosing the window repair company. This will provide you with the assurance that the company is trustworthy and that they will follow all safety protocols when performing the work. Asking for references and testimonials from previous customers can be a great way to learn more about the company.
It is also important to make sure that the window repair service you hire is licensed and insured legally. This is a requirement in some states. This information should be accessible on the company website or by contact their office.
Based on the needs and budget of your home, you could need to decide between replacing the entire window or just one pane. A reputable window company will help you to understand the pros and con of each option, and help you make the best choice for your home.
The cost of replacing a window differs depending on the type of window and material, the size, and design of the window. You'll pay more upfront for energy efficient glass, but you'll save money over the long run. In some areas you may be eligible for public assistance in order to lower the cost of replacing windows.
